I'O (pronounced ee-oh), is Maui's original "farm to fork" restaurant serving Hawaiian regional cuisine in a contemporary beachfront setting. Acclaimed chef and partner James McDonald combines organic produce from the restaurant's very own I'o Farm with meat from upcountry ranches and fresh local fish. I'o is Maui's only DiRona Award recipient, and has achieved many accolades for innovative and sustainable cuisine. For wine aficionados there is an extensive and varied wine list, which has earned Wine Spectators' "Award of Excellence" consecutively for over a decade. I'o is one of Maui's true eclectic culinary gems!

"A great restaurant with top-notch food quality. The fish and sauces were amazing, and many products come from their own farm, including greens and even tea. It is also notable that one can order fish and side dishes separately, to get the best combination. A very pleasant experience and perfect, friendly service.
The restaurant has a nice outdoor terrace with a view of the ocean. One thing to take into account is that there is a Luau place next to it, and its entrance is between this restaurant's veranda and the ocean. So there is a lot of entertainment/noise one hears anyway. Some purists might find a certain discrepancy between the cuisine and ambient soundstage :-). Personally, we didn't have much trouble with that..."
